Hi Frankie, From your screenshots I beleive this works as intended. You need minimum tools to collect different blocks. You can break them slowly with just about anything, but, using your first screenshot as an example, breaking diorite with sand in your hand won't drop a block of diorite. You need a wooden pick or better to break this block and be able to collect it. Moderators, please mark this issue as resolved. |
